I liked this book for a couple of reasons. First I liked that the illustrations really connected to the text. Second, I liked that it was a short story but contained a little bit of information about the African culture. Lastly, I liked that the story showed two sides of Africa, the city and the wild, and a little boys imagination. Cute book.

While the surface story of "Somewhere In Africa" deals with a young boy, Ashraf, and his desire to see real African wildlife, the undertone of this book has a much deeper meaning. Highlighting the differences between urbanized South African and the Saharan Plains, Ingrid Mennen, presumedly intends to touch on the subject of cultural and regional misconceptions. The bringing of focus to the city aspect of African life, and and the neighborhood that Ashraf lives in, shows both the uniqueness and commonality of human culture. This book would serve as a great read aloud session for geography.… (altro)
